Sonos PLAYBASE Wireless Speaker Goes Under TV

Sonos PLAYBASE in White

Under-the-TV Speaker Does Double Duty as Sound Bar or Wireless Loudspeaker

Sonos announced their latest speaker for the home called PLAYBASE. This $700 versatile speaker is designed to be placed under a TV so it can double as a sound bar or wireless music speaker. It also works seamlessly with the Sonos app, and the company’s companion wireless subwoofer, and surround speakers for a home theater experience without wires. This products marks Sonos’ first entry into the soundbase category and follows the 4-year old PLAYBAR sound bar.

PLAYBASE stands 2-1/4 inches high (58mm) and packs in 10 custom-designed drivers with dedicated amplifiers — six mid-range, three tweeters, and one woofer. Each are powered by software to precisely control the sound coming from each transducer. The company says this configuration provides a sound stage much wider than the speaker itself.

To further improve both aesthetics and acoustics the front grill includes more than 43,000 holes to make it acoustically transparent. The company says PLAYBASE was built from the ground-up with unique manufacturing processes and materials to meet the level of quality Sonos stands by, including a complex insert molding process and a custom-designed glass-filled polycarbonate exterior to keep vibration to a minimum and withstand the weight of a TV for years to come.

Designed for TVs that aren’t wall-mounted, PLAYBASE is easy to control and set-up using just two cords (optical and power). It expands to other rooms when wirelessly connected to your Sonos home sound system, and is equal parts TV speaker and music speaker, with access to more than 80 music services. Later this year, like every other Sonos speaker, you’ll soon be able to control PLAYBASE using your voice and any Amazon Alexa enabled device.

Sonos also includes its proprietary Trueplay feature which adjusts the sound of PLAYBASE to the acoustics of the room. In addition, Dialogue Enhancement and Night Mode allow for enhanced vocal clarity or toned down bass for loud action scenes.  All options are configured via the Sonos smartphone app.

Price and Availability
The Sonos PLAYBASE will be available April 4, 2017 in black or white for $699 at Amazon or direct from sonos.com.
